Abstract

The area of Fujian province is divided into 4 361 grid points with geographic information and the acceleration by 0.05° degree(about 5 km) grid discretion,and every grid point can quickly get the peak acceleration of ground motion after earthquake,and the method of earthquake hazard estimation is given based on peak acceleration of ground motion.
